Simulation candle anti-theft money pot

By designing a simulated candle anti-theft piggy bank, and utilizing the threaded engagement structure of the candle shell and the support bracket, it serves as a home decoration while providing secure storage space, solving the problem of insufficient concealment in existing storage cabinets and reducing the risk of valuables being stolen.

Abstract

The utility model relates to the technical field of anti-theft money pots, and discloses a simulated candle anti-theft money pot which comprises a candle shell, a money pot body is arranged on the inner side of the candle shell, a supporting bracket is connected to the bottom of the candle shell in a threaded and sleeved mode, a cylindrical groove is formed in the bottom of the supporting bracket, and a fixing strip is fixedly connected to the top of the inner wall of the cylindrical groove. A flame-imitating machine core is installed in the middle of the top of the candle shell, the bottom of the candle shell is of a cylindrical opening structure, an annular frame is arranged on the periphery of the top of the supporting bracket, the annular frame and the supporting bracket are of an integrally-formed structure, first threads are arranged on the periphery of the outer side of the annular frame, and second threads are arranged at the bottom of the inner wall of the candle shell. And the second thread is meshed with the first thread. By arranging the candle shell and the supporting bracket, the money pot main body can be placed, some valuables can be stored and are not easy to perceive, the concealment can effectively avoid the attention of other people, and the risk that the valuables are stolen is reduced.

Description

Technical Field

[0001] This utility model relates to the field of anti-theft piggy bank technology, and more specifically, to an anti-theft piggy bank with simulated candle design. Background Technology

[0002] Many families store valuables such as cash, gold, and diamond rings in wardrobes, lockers, or safes. When committing theft, criminals often target the places residents habitually store their valuables, turning what residents consider safe and secure locations into the most insecure places. This results in poor concealment and theft prevention for valuables. Therefore, this invention proposes a simulated candle-shaped anti-theft piggy bank to solve the aforementioned technical problems. Utility Model Content

[0003] In order to overcome the shortcomings of the existing technology, this utility model provides a simulated candle anti-theft piggy bank.

[0004] To achieve the above objectives, this utility model provides the following technical solution: a simulated candle anti-theft piggy bank, comprising a candle shell, a piggy bank body disposed on the inner side of the candle shell, a support bracket threaded onto the bottom of the candle shell, a cylindrical groove formed at the bottom of the support bracket, a fixing strip fixedly connected to the top of the inner wall of the cylindrical groove, a simulated flame mechanism installed in the middle of the top of the candle shell, a cylindrical opening structure at the bottom of the candle shell, an annular frame disposed around the top of the support bracket, the annular frame and the support bracket being integrally formed, a first thread disposed around the outer perimeter of the annular frame, and a second thread disposed at the bottom of the inner wall of the candle shell, the second thread engaging with the first thread.

[0005] As a preferred embodiment of this utility model, a battery box is provided on the top of the front side of the candle shell, and a battery body is installed inside the battery box.

[0006] As a preferred embodiment of this utility model, a battery cover is installed on the top of the front of the candle shell, and the battery cover is compatible with the battery box.

[0007] As a preferred technical solution of this utility model, a switch block is provided on the front of the candle shell, and the switch block, the battery body and the flame-imitating mechanism are all electrically connected by wires.

[0008] As a preferred embodiment of this utility model, the candle shell, battery cover, battery box, and support bracket are all made of ABS material.

[0009] As a preferred embodiment of this utility model, the flame-like mechanism is assembled to the middle of the top of the candle shell via a slot and glue.

[0010] Compared with the prior art, the beneficial effects of this utility model are as follows:

[0011] This invention features a candle shell and a support holder. The candle shell is shaped like a candle, and the battery provides power to a flame-like mechanism that emits light, allowing it to function as a normal decorative item. The support holder is fixedly connected to the bottom of the candle shell, creating a closed space inside for holding the main body of the piggy bank. This space can not only hold the piggy bank itself but also store valuables. Because simulated candles are commonly used in home decoration and are not easily noticed, this concealment effectively avoids attracting attention and reduces the risk of theft of valuables. [0018] like Figures 1 to 4As shown, this utility model provides a simulated candle anti-theft piggy bank, including a candle shell 1, a piggy bank body 4 disposed on the inner side of the candle shell 1, a support bracket 3 threadedly connected to the bottom of the candle shell 1, a cylindrical groove 301 opened at the bottom of the support bracket 3, a fixing strip 302 fixedly connected to the top of the inner wall of the cylindrical groove 301, a flame-simulating mechanism 2 installed in the middle of the top of the candle shell 1, the flame-simulating mechanism 2 being assembled in the middle of the top of the candle shell 1 by means of a slot and glue, the bottom of the candle shell 1 having a cylindrical opening structure, an annular frame 31 disposed around the top of the support bracket 3, the annular frame 31 and the support bracket 3 being integrally formed, a first thread 32 disposed around the outer perimeter of the annular frame 31, a second thread 11 disposed at the bottom of the inner wall of the candle shell 1, the second thread 11 engaging with the first thread 32.

[0019] In this embodiment, the overall shape of the candle shell 1 is that of a candle. The battery body 103 provides power to the imitation flame mechanism 2, which can emit light and function as a normal decoration. The fixing strip 302 facilitates the rotation of the support bracket 3. Due to the meshing of the first thread 32 and the second thread 11, when the fixing strip 302 is rotated counterclockwise, the support bracket 3 separates from the bottom of the candle shell 1, thus keeping the bottom of the candle shell 1 open. This makes it easy to place the piggy bank body 4 inside the candle shell 1 or remove the piggy bank body 4 from the inside of the candle shell 1. When the fixing strip 302 is rotated clockwise, the support bracket 3 is fixedly connected to the bottom of the candle shell 1, forming a closed space inside the candle shell 1 for placing the piggy bank body 4. This space can not only be used to place the piggy bank body 4 but also to store some valuables. Since simulated candles are commonly used in home decoration and are not easily noticed, this concealment can effectively avoid the attention of others and reduce the risk of theft.

[0020] The top of the front of the candle casing 1 is provided with a battery box 104, and the battery body 103 is installed inside the battery box 104.

[0021] The battery box 104 is used to fix the battery body 103, so that a circuit loop is formed between the battery body 103, the flame-shaped mechanism 2 and the switch block 102.

[0022] The top of the front of the candle casing 1 is equipped with a battery cover 101, which is compatible with the battery box 104.

[0023] The battery box 104 is installed on the front of the battery box 104 by a snap-fit ​​structure, which protects the battery body 103 and prevents the battery body 103 from falling out of the battery box 104 in the event of an impact or drop.

[0024] The candle housing 1 has a switch lever 102 on its front side. The switch lever 102, the battery body 103, and the flame-imitating mechanism 2 are all electrically connected by wires.

[0025] The switch lever 102 controls the opening and closing of the circuit between the battery body 103 and the imitation flame mechanism 2.

[0026] Among them, the candle shell 1, battery cover 101, battery box 104 and support bracket 3 are all made of ABS material. ABS has strong impact resistance and can maintain its toughness and strength at low temperatures, preventing damage caused by external impact or drop.
